Optical response of electrons in a random potential
Weisse, Alexander · Schubert, Gerald · Fehske, Holger
Original · EN
Using our recently developed Chebyshev expansion technique for finite-temperature dynamical correlation functions we numerically study the AC conductivity σ(ω) of the Anderson model on large cubic clusters of up to 100³ sites. Extending previous results we focus on the role of the boundary conditions and check the consistency of the DC limit, ω→ 0, by comparing with direct conductance calculations based on a Greens function approach in a Landauer Büttiker type setup.
